Pradhan Mantri Mudra Yojana (PMMY) is a flagship scheme launched by the Government of India with the aim to facilitate micro credit/loans up to Rs. 10 lakhs. This scheme is specifically designed to support income-generating micro enterprises engaged in the non-farm sector, which includes manufacturing, trading, and service sectors. Activities allied to agriculture such as poultry, dairy, beekeeping, etc., are also covered under PMMY.

What is PMMY?

PMMY provides financial assistance to non-corporate, non-farm sector income-generating activities of micro and small entities. These entities are the backbone of India’s economy, comprising millions of proprietorship and partnership firms. These firms operate in various sectors including:

  • Small manufacturing units
  • Service sector units
  • Shopkeepers
  • Fruits/vegetable vendors
  • Truck operators
  • Food-service units
  • Repair shops
  • Machine operators
  • Small industries
  • Artisans
  • Food processors

Eligible Member Lending Institutions

The loans under Pradhan Mantri Mudra Yojana can be availed through eligible Member Lending Institutions (MLIs). These institutions include:

  • Public Sector Banks
  • Private Sector Banks
  • State operated cooperative banks
  • Regional Rural Banks
  • Micro Finance Institutions (MFIs)
  • Non-Banking Finance Companies (NBFCs)
  • Small Finance Banks (SFBs)
  • Other financial intermediaries approved by Mudra Ltd. as member financial institutions

Interest Rates and Processing Charges

The interest rates for loans under PMMY are determined by the Member Lending Institutions based on the guidelines provided by the Reserve Bank of India. These rates may vary from time to time. Additionally, there might be upfront fees or processing charges applicable as per the norms of the respective lending institution.

Top 20 FAQs about Pradhan Mantri Mudra Yojana (PMMY)

1. What is Pradhan Mantri Mudra Yojana (PMMY)?

Answer: PMMY is a flagship scheme by the Government of India that provides micro credit/loans up to Rs. 10 lakhs to income-generating micro enterprises in the non-farm sector, including manufacturing, trading, and service sectors.

2. Who is eligible to apply for a loan under PMMY?

Answer: Any Indian citizen who has a business plan for a non-farm income-generating activity such as manufacturing, processing, trading, or service sector, and requires a loan up to Rs. 10 lakhs can apply.

3. What are the types of loans available under PMMY?

Answer: Loans are classified into three categories:

  • Shishu: Covering loans up to Rs. 50,000.
  • Kishore: Covering loans above Rs. 50,000 and up to Rs. 5 lakhs.
  • Tarun: Covering loans above Rs. 5 lakhs and up to Rs. 10 lakhs.

4. What types of businesses are eligible for PMMY loans?

Answer: Eligible businesses include small manufacturing units, service sector units, shopkeepers, fruits/vegetable vendors, truck operators, food-service units, repair shops, machine operators, small industries, artisans, food processors, and activities allied to agriculture such as poultry, dairy, and beekeeping.

5. Which financial institutions offer PMMY loans?

Answer: Loans can be availed through Public Sector Banks, Private Sector Banks, State Cooperative Banks, Regional Rural Banks, Micro Finance Institutions (MFIs), Non-Banking Finance Companies (NBFCs), Small Finance Banks (SFBs), and other financial intermediaries approved by Mudra Ltd.

6. What is the interest rate for PMMY loans?

Answer: The interest rate is determined by the Member Lending Institutions based on the Reserve Bank of India guidelines and may vary from time to time.

7. Are there any processing charges for PMMY loans?

Answer: Processing charges are determined by the lending institutions and may vary. Applicants should check with the respective institution for details.

8. How can one apply for a PMMY loan?

Answer: Interested individuals can apply by visiting the nearest eligible Member Lending Institution and submitting the required documents and a business plan.

9. What documents are required to apply for a PMMY loan?

Answer: Typical documents include identity proof, address proof, business plan, and other documents as required by the lending institution.

10. Is collateral required for PMMY loans?

Answer: Generally, PMMY loans are collateral-free. However, it is best to confirm with the lending institution.

11. What is the repayment period for PMMY loans?

Answer: The repayment period varies based on the amount of the loan and the business plan. It is usually decided by the lending institution.

12. Can existing businesses apply for PMMY loans?

Answer: Yes, both new and existing businesses can apply for loans under PMMY.

13. What is the role of Mudra Ltd. in PMMY?

Answer: Mudra Ltd. provides refinancing support to the Member Lending Institutions for lending to micro units and monitors the implementation of the scheme.

14. Are there any subsidies available under PMMY?

Answer: PMMY itself does not provide subsidies. However, interest subvention or subsidies might be available under other related government schemes.

15. How can I track the status of my PMMY loan application?

Answer: You can track the status by contacting the lending institution where you applied for the loan.

16. What should I do if my PMMY loan application is rejected?

Answer: If your application is rejected, you can seek clarification from the lending institution and address any issues or discrepancies. You may also approach other eligible institutions.

17. Can PMMY loans be used for personal expenses?

Answer: No, PMMY loans are strictly for business purposes to generate income and cannot be used for personal expenses.

18. Is there any training or support provided for loan applicants under PMMY?

Answer: Various Member Lending Institutions and other government agencies may provide training and support for entrepreneurs to effectively utilize the loans.

19. How does PMMY benefit women entrepreneurs?

Answer: PMMY encourages women entrepreneurs by providing them with easier access to credit, potentially at lower interest rates and without the need for collateral.
